Article: India: Patni Computer promoters to take call on stake sale by January.

Byline: manish03

Reviving plans to offload part of their holdings in Patni Computer Systems, promoters are studying offers from various companies, according to market sources. A clear decision on bids from various contenders for the promoter holdings, added the sources, was expected by January. The three Patni brothers, non-executive chairman Narendra Patni and his younger brothers, Gajendra and Ashok, hold equal stakes totalling 48.3 per cent in India s sixth-largest software exporter. Private equity company General Atlantic holds 18 per cent, while the rest is public.
